What is Healthcare Email Support in BPO?

Healthcare Email Support in BPO refers to outsourcing email communication tasks to third-party providers who specialize in the healthcare industry. These providers are equipped with the necessary tools and expertise to handle a wide range of email-based interactions, such as patient inquiries, appointment confirmations, billing issues, insurance claims, and general support.

BPO providers offer a dedicated team of professionals trained to manage all email interactions in compliance with healthcare regulations such as H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act). This service is designed to streamline communication between healthcare providers and patients, improving response times and patient satisfaction while also optimizing operational efficiency.

Types of Healthcare Email Support in BPO

Healthcare organizations require diverse types of support, which can be handled effectively through email. Here are the main types of Healthcare Email Support in BPO:

1. Patient Inquiries and General Support

Patients often reach out to healthcare providers for general information, such as office hours, doctor availability, or service details. Email support can be used to handle these inquiries, providing timely and clear responses to patients.

Benefits:

  • Quick Responses: Ensures that patients receive prompt replies to basic inquiries.
  • Reduced Call Volume: Minimizes phone-based inquiries, freeing up call center agents for more complex tasks.
  • Convenient Communication: Allows patients to send inquiries at their convenience, receiving responses during business hours.

2. Appointment Scheduling and Reminders

Email support is an ideal channel for scheduling appointments, confirming bookings, and sending reminders for upcoming visits. Automated email systems can handle appointment confirmations, cancellations, and reminders, improving patient attendance rates.

Benefits:

  • Improved Attendance: Reduces missed appointments with automated reminders.
  • Streamlined Scheduling: Simplifies the process of booking and rescheduling appointments.
  • Personalized Communication: Emails can include specific instructions or pre-visit preparations.

3. Billing and Payment Queries

Many patients need clarification on their medical bills, payment procedures, or insurance coverage. Email support allows patients to send detailed billing inquiries, and BPO agents can provide breakdowns, explain charges, and help resolve payment issues.

Benefits:

  • Clearer Communication: Helps patients understand their bills with detailed explanations.
  • Timely Resolutions: Billing disputes can be resolved promptly through email exchanges.
  • Reduced Frustration: Patients can easily follow up on their concerns without long waiting times.

4. Insurance Verification and Claims Assistance

Email support is essential for assisting patients with insurance verifications, claim status updates, and clarifications on their coverage. BPO agents can communicate directly with insurance companies, ensuring that patients’ claims are processed efficiently.

Benefits:

  • Simplified Insurance Process: Patients can receive status updates and coverage explanations.
  • Faster Claims Processing: Ensures that claims are submitted and followed up on quickly.
  • Increased Patient Satisfaction: Helps patients understand the complexities of insurance claims and reduces confusion.

5. Post-Treatment Follow-Up and Care Instructions

After treatment or medical procedures, patients often require follow-up information or post-care instructions. Email support allows healthcare organizations to send detailed follow-up care instructions, prescriptions, and wellness reminders.

Benefits:

  • Enhanced Patient Outcomes: Clear instructions can improve recovery and adherence to post-treatment plans.
  • Continuous Engagement: Keeps patients informed even after their visits, fostering a sense of care and attention.
  • Convenient Follow-Ups: Patients can reference emails at any time for detailed instructions.

6. Feedback Collection and Surveys

Healthcare organizations can use email support for collecting patient feedback or sending out satisfaction surveys. Gathering feedback via email is a simple and effective way to measure patient satisfaction and identify areas of improvement.

Benefits:

  • Actionable Insights: Provides data that can be used to improve healthcare services.
  • Patient Engagement: Involves patients in the quality improvement process.
  • Cost-Effective Data Collection: Surveys and feedback requests can be automated, reducing the need for phone calls or in-person interactions.

Benefits of Healthcare Email Support in BPO

Outsourcing email support to a reliable BPO provider can bring a multitude of benefits for healthcare organizations:

1. Improved Efficiency

By outsourcing email communication tasks, healthcare organizations can optimize their internal resources, allowing them to focus on more critical functions. BPO providers have the experience and tools to handle large volumes of emails efficiently, ensuring that responses are prompt and accurate.

2. Cost Savings

Hiring and maintaining an in-house email support team can be expensive. Outsourcing to a BPO provider can significantly reduce overhead costs, as you won’t need to invest in recruitment, training, or infrastructure. The scalability of BPO services also allows healthcare organizations to adjust their email support capacity based on demand.

3. 24/7 Availability

Many BPO providers offer round-the-clock support, ensuring that patient inquiries are addressed even after business hours. This availability helps ensure that patients receive timely responses, which is critical for urgent matters such as appointment scheduling or billing issues.

4. Compliance and Data Security

BPO providers specializing in healthcare are well-versed in the regulatory requirements surrounding patient data and communication. They ensure that email support interactions are HIPAA-compliant, safeguarding patient confidentiality and preventing data breaches.

5. Enhanced Patient Satisfaction

Timely and personalized responses to patient queries are crucial in maintaining a positive patient experience. Healthcare email support provides a convenient, easy-to-access way for patients to communicate, fostering better relationships and trust between patients and healthcare providers.

6. Streamlined Operations

Outsourcing email support helps streamline operations by consolidating patient interactions in one channel. It allows healthcare organizations to better track communications, monitor response times, and ensure that patient needs are met effectively.

How to Choose the Right Healthcare Email Support BPO

Choosing the right BPO provider for healthcare email support is crucial for ensuring optimal service. Here are a few key factors to consider:

1. Experience and Expertise

Select a BPO provider with a proven track record in the healthcare industry. They should be familiar with healthcare terminology, regulations, and the specific challenges healthcare organizations face when it comes to communication.

2. HIPAA Compliance

Ensure that the BPO provider adheres to HIPAA regulations to protect patient privacy and sensitive information. The provider should have robust security measures in place for handling patient data securely.

3. Response Time and Efficiency

Check the provider’s response time and efficiency in handling emails. Patients should receive timely and accurate replies, whether the issue is straightforward or more complex.

4. Scalability

As your healthcare organization grows, the volume of email inquiries may increase. Choose a BPO provider that offers scalable solutions to accommodate changing needs without sacrificing quality.

5. Technology and Tools

Ensure that the BPO provider uses advanced email management tools and customer relationship management (CRM) systems to track, prioritize, and respond to emails efficiently.
